Packraft México began with a simple idea: use packrafts to connect people with Mexico’s rivers in a way that is safe, respectful, and locally led.
We are based in Chiapas and work with Mexican guides, instructors, communities, and conservation partners to grow paddlesports from the inside out. Our goal is not just to run trips — it is to create future river leaders in Mexico.

Packrafting in Mexico is more than just paddling beautiful rivers. It requires local knowledge, strong safety systems, responsible access, and respect for the communities and protected areas connected to each river.
We are not just visiting these places. We are building long-term river culture in Mexico.

Mexico’s rivers are not just destinations. They are connected to communities, access agreements, local knowledge, conservation challenges, and long-term relationships.
When you paddle with Packraft México, you are supporting guides who live here, train here, and are helping build the future of paddlesports in Mexico.

Every Packraft México course and expedition includes instruction. We focus not only on paddling technique, but also on judgment, group management, communication, rescue planning, and responsible travel in remote environments.

Rodrigo Alfonzo / Packraft México received the American Packrafting Association’s Golden Paddle Award in recognition of work supporting the growth of packrafting, local access, and community-based paddling development in Mexico. Read more →
